- Katılım
- 17 Ocak 2008
- Mesajlar
- 227
- Excel Vers. ve Dili
- 2007 ve 2013 kullanıyorum
verisiyon türkçe
Arkadaşlar elim de daha önceden bu siteden arkadaşların vermiş olduğu bir kod var sizden istediğim teke düşürerek aktarma işleminde B sütununda ki verileri de teke düşürerek aktarması, örnek dosya gönderiyorum, yardımlarınız için şimdiden teşekkür ediyorum.
Private Sub Worksheet_Activate()
Dim i As Integer, son As Integer, sat As Integer
With Sheets("Veri")
son = .Range("C" & Rows.Count).End(3).Row
Range("A2:B" & Rows.Count).ClearContents
sat = 2
For i = 2 To son
If WorksheetFunction.CountIf(.Range("C2:C" & i), .Cells(i, 3)) = 1 Then
Cells(sat, "A") = .Cells(i, 3)
Cells(sat, "B") = WorksheetFunction.CountIf(.Range("C2:C" & son), .Cells(i, "C"))
sat = sat + 1
End If
Next i
End With
End Sub
Private Sub Worksheet_Activate()
Dim i As Integer, son As Integer, sat As Integer
With Sheets("Veri")
son = .Range("C" & Rows.Count).End(3).Row
Range("A2:B" & Rows.Count).ClearContents
sat = 2
For i = 2 To son
If WorksheetFunction.CountIf(.Range("C2:C" & i), .Cells(i, 3)) = 1 Then
Cells(sat, "A") = .Cells(i, 3)
Cells(sat, "B") = WorksheetFunction.CountIf(.Range("C2:C" & son), .Cells(i, "C"))
sat = sat + 1
End If
Next i
End With
End Sub
